LPN Home Health Nurse PRN Position Available In Cheatham, Tennessee
Tallo's Job Summary: LPN Home Health Nurse PRN position available at HomeFirst Home Healthcare in Pleasant View, TN. Part-time role with a pay rate of $28-$30 per hour, offering benefits such as mileage reimbursement, health insurance, and paid time off. Responsibilities include administering skilled nursing care in patients' homes, documenting patient care, and collaborating with the interdisciplinary team. Requirements include LPN license, CPR certification, and one year of experience in a healthcare setting.
